Home > Consulting Services > Config Mgmt > SW Config Mgmt > Documentation Documentation Software Configuration Management Technologies and Applications May 1999 Software Configuration Management (SCM) is the backbone of the software development process. When it is implemented correctly it helps ensure software quality and process improvement. The purpose of this report is to provide current information on basic SCM principles, methods, and technologies, and identify their value in improving software quality. It should be used as a first step in transferring effective SCM processes and products into practical use. This report also provides an overview of SCM concepts, what it is and how to implement an SCM process as well as SCM standards, current trends and future directions for SCM, measurements and metrics, case studies, and lessons learned. Emphasis is placed on the need for organizations to develop a long-term SCM solution by developing a detailed SCM plan and defining the SCM process before implementing an automated system.
